Article 4. Legal protection of trademarks Chapter 2. Legal protection and conditions of trademark registration On trademarks, service marks, geographical indications and names of places of origin of goods
1. Legal protection of trademarks in the Republic of Kazakhstan is granted on the basis of their registration in accordance with the procedure established by this Law, as well as without registration by virtue of international treaties of the Republic of Kazakhstan.
2. Legal protection of trademarks is provided to individuals or legal entities.
The exclusive right to a trademark arises from the date of registration of the trademark in the State Register of Trademarks.
3. The right to a trademark is certified by a certificate and confirmed by an extract from the State Register of Trademarks.
The form of the certificate is established by the authorized body.
4. The trademark owner has the exclusive right to use and dispose of the trademark belonging to him in respect of the goods and services indicated in the certificate. No one may use a trademark protected in the Republic of Kazakhstan without the consent of the owner.
The Law of the Republic of Kazakhstan dated July 26, 1999 No. 456.
This Law regulates relations arising in connection with the registration, legal protection and use of trademarks, service marks, geographical indications and names of places of origin of goods in the Republic of Kazakhstan.
